Securing Your BMS: Best Practices for Digital Safety
Protecting your property's Building System (BMS) is absolutely important in today's digital landscape. Adopting robust security protocols is no longer optional. Start by regularly updating firmware and programs to fix known vulnerabilities. Limit access by employing strong authentication and two-factor security. Moreover , separate your network to prevent rogue access and define specific response plans to address any incidents . Finally, perform periodic penetration scans to uncover and fix any gaps before they can be leveraged by hackers or malicious actors.

Beyond Passwords: Advanced BMS Cybersecurity Strategies
The reliance on standard passwords for Building Management System (BMS) protection is ever more insufficient in today's sophisticated threat landscape. Current BMS cybersecurity methods must extend far beyond this basic layer. A reliable defense BMS Digital Safety requires a comprehensive solution, encompassing multiple critical elements. These include implementing multi-factor verification, periodically conducting vulnerability assessments, and actively monitoring network activity. Furthermore, segmenting the BMS system from main IT systems is vital to prevent widespread movement in a compromise. Finally, continuous personnel training on cybersecurity best methods is vital to reduce the threat of user error.
- Implement Multi-Factor Authentication
- Undertake Periodic Risk Assessments
- Track Network Data
- Segment the BMS System
- Offer Ongoing Staff Education
